The three pillars of BIM coordination
- Hard clash detection — components occupying the same physical space
- Soft clash (clearance) detection — safety, insulation and maintenance access
- 4D workflow clashes — temporal conflicts in the installation sequence
Our mitigation process
We don't just flag problems — we engineer the solution.
- Federated model creation across all disciplines
- Automated clash reporting categorized by severity and discipline
- Conflict resolution — rerouting services, adjusting elevations, modifying connections
- Coordination meetings to resolve the 'big rocks' collectively
- Final zero-clash validation before shop drawing release
